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/jeevan-2005/g1_choudhary
This repository contains my personal portfolio website, built using Vite and React. The portfolio showcases my projects, skills, and experiences as a Computer Science and Engineering student at IIIT Kota.
https://github.com/jeevan-2005/g1_choudhary
developer-portfolio html5 lottie-react portfolio react-js react-spring react-template redux redux-thunk sass vite-react
Last synced: about 1 month ago
JSON representation
This repository contains my personal portfolio website, built using Vite and React. The portfolio showcases my projects, skills, and experiences as a Computer Science and Engineering student at IIIT Kota.
- Host: GitHub
- URL: https://github.com/jeevan-2005/g1_choudhary
- Owner: jeevan-2005
- Created: 2024-06-19T05:32:55.000Z (5 months ago)
- Default Branch: main
- Last Pushed: 2024-08-14T13:35:21.000Z (3 months ago)
- Last Synced: 2024-09-26T17:41:39.710Z (about 2 months ago)
- Topics: developer-portfolio, html5, lottie-react, portfolio, react-js, react-spring, react-template, redux, redux-thunk, sass, vite-react
- Language: JavaScript
- Homepage: https://g1-choudhary.vercel.app
- Size: 8.82 MB
- Stars: 0
- Watchers: 1
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
Awesome Lists containing this project
README
# Personal Portfolio
This repository contains my personal portfolio website, built using Vite and React. The portfolio showcases my projects, skills, and experiences as a Computer Science and Engineering student at IIIT Kota.
## Deploy Link
Check out the live demo of my portfolio [here](https://g1-choudhary.vercel.app/).## Features
- **Modern Tech Stack**: Developed using Vite for fast build times and React for a dynamic user interface.
- **Responsive Design**: Fully responsive design ensuring optimal viewing experience on all devices.
- **Dark Mode**: User-friendly dark mode toggle for a comfortable browsing experience.
- **Interactive UI**: Engaging and interactive user interface with smooth transitions and animations.
- **Projects Showcase**: Detailed presentation of my projects, including live demos and source code links.
- **Skills Section**: Highlight of my technical skills and competencies.
- **Contact Form**: Easy-to-use contact form for potential collaborations or inquiries.## Screenshots
### Light Mode
![Light Mode](https://github.com/user-attachments/assets/3fce1e65-a526-4956-9315-3ecd2bdc77a5)
### Dark Mode
![Dark Mode](https://github.com/user-attachments/assets/55d88b00-e5ad-4745-bc8e-387b2254d1e4)
## Technologies Used
- **Vite**: Next Generation Frontend Tooling
- **React**: JavaScript library for building user interfaces
- **Sass**: Syntactically Awesome Style Sheets
- **JavaScript (ES6+)**: Programming language
- **Redux**: Predictable state container for JavaScript apps## Illustrations
- [unDraw](https://undraw.co)
## Future Enhancements
- **Performance Optimization**: Further optimization for faster load times and improved performance.
- **Experience Section**: Add a section to detail professional and academic experiences.## Installation
To get a local copy up and running, follow these simple steps:
1. **Clone the repository**:
```sh
git clone https://github.com/jeevan-2005/g1_choudhary.git
```
2. **Navigate to the project directory**:
```sh
cd developerPortfolio
```
3. **Install dependencies**:
```sh
npm install
```
4. **Start the application**:
```sh
npm run dev
```## Contributing
Contributions are what make the open source community such an amazing place to be learn, inspire, and create. Any contributions you make are **greatly appreciated**.
1. Fork the Project.
2. Create your Feature Branch (`git checkout -b feature/AmazingFeature`).
3. Commit your Changes (`git commit -m 'Add some AmazingFeature'`).
4. Push to the Branch (`git push origin feature/AmazingFeature`).
5. Open a Pull Request.## Star the Repo
If you like this project, please give it a ⭐ on [GitHub](https://github.com/jeevan-2005/g1_choudhary.git)!
---
Thank you for checking out my portfolio! If you have any questions or feedback, feel free to reach out.